Draw length is the distance you have to pull a bow’s string back (as measured from the riser) to reach your perfect anchor point (where your string hand meets your face) at full draw. Use the draw length calculator to find your correct draw length based on your arm span. You can also go to an archery store and use a draw length board or even an online calculator to save you on the math. Accurate draw length is essential because it affects your shooting form, comfort, and effectiveness.
